Unexpected Error using CASE WHEN formula on custom Date/Time field
Hey all,
Wondering if anyone else has experienced this?
I'm trying to do a VERY simple CASE WHEN formula as a result on a transaction search. Criteria:
Type = SO
Main Line = T
Result:
Formula (text) CASE WHEN ({custbodya}-{custbodyb})>0 THEN '2' ELSE '1' END
{custbodya} and {custbodyb} are BOTH custom date/time fields.
I end up getting an unexpected error, yet:
1. When I do this with standard NS fields (on a case record, etc.), I get no error
2. The simple arithmetic of {custbodya}-{custbodyb} in its own formula DOES work. It only fails when the arithmetic is combined with the CASE WHEN.
